This document provides an introduction to assistive technology (AT). It defines AT and gives examples for various purposes including listening, math, organization/memory, reading, and writing. The objectives are to describe AT, list examples, identify appropriate AT for needs, and recognize benefits. Advantages of AT include individualized learning support, availability to all students, aid across subjects, and independence promotion. Tips for teachers include using AT as supplements, having computers set up for AT, collaborating with other professionals, and familiarizing all students with AT.

At the StampedeCon 2015 Big Data Conference: The global Monsanto R&D pipeline produces millions of new plant populations every year; each which contributes to a dataset of genetic ancestry spanning several decades. Historically the constraints of modeling and processing this data within an RDBMS has made drawing inferences from this dataset complex and computationally infeasible at large scale. Fortunately, the genetic history of any plant population forms a naturally occurring directed acyclic graph, a property that has allowed us to utilize graph theory to re-imagine how ancestral lineage data is modeled, stored, and queried.
In this talk we present our solutions to these problems, as realized using a graph-based approach within Neo4j. We will discuss our learnings around using Neo4j in a production setting that includes transactional and high-throughput computation, including how we transitioned from recursive JOIN queries to using Cypher and the Neo4j traversal framework to take full advantage of index-free adjacency. Our approach to polyglot persistence will be discussed via our use of a distributed commit log, Apache Kafka, to feed our graph store from sources of live transactional data. Finally, we will touch upon how we are using these technologies to annotate our genetic ancestry dataset with molecular genomics data in order to build an pipeline-scale genotype imputation platform with core algorithms built using Apache Spark.

The French Revolution, which began in 1789, was a period of radical social and political upheaval in France. It marked the decline of absolute monarchies, the rise of secular and democratic republics, and the eventual rise of Napoleon Bonaparte. This revolutionary period is crucial in understanding the transition from feudalism to modernity in Europe.

5. 6-Dec-12 Assistive Technology
Assistive technology in special education refers
to any devices or services that are necessary for
a child to benefit from special education or
related services or to enable the child to be
educated in the least restrictive environment.
Used to enhance the functional independence of
a person with a disability.
Helps people with disabilities to overcome
various challenges they face.

7. 6-Dec-12 Assistive Technology
The term Assistive Technology Service includes:
a. The evaluation of the needs of a child with a
disability, including a functional evaluation of the
child in the child’s customary environment;
b. Purchasing, leasing, or otherwise providing for the
acquisition of assistive technology devices by
children with disabilities;
c. Selecting, designing, fitting, customizing, adapting,
applying, retaining, repairing, or replacing assistive
technology devices;
D.E.T. , S.N.D.T. Women’s University
7
8. 6-Dec-12 Assistive Technology
The term Assistive Technology Service includes:
d. Coordinating and using other
therapies, interventions, or services with assistive
technology devices, such as those associated with
existing education and rehabilitation plans and
programs;
e. Training or technical assistance for a child with a
disability or, if appropriate, that child’s family; and
f. Training or technical assistance for
professionals, who are otherwise substantially
involved in the major life functions of children with
disabilities.

10. 6-Dec-12 Assistive Technology
Listening
Assistive technology (AT) tools for listening are
designed to help people who have difficulty in
hearing, processing and remembering spoken
language.
Few examples of AT for listening are:
› Personal FM learning Systems
› Variable Speed Tape Recorders
D.E.T. , S.N.D.T. Women’s University
10
11. 6-Dec-12 Assistive Technology
Listening
Personal FM learning Systems:
A personal FM listening system transmits a speaker's
voice directly to the user's ear.
This may help the listener focus on what the speaker
is saying.
The unit consists of a wireless transmitter (with
microphone) worn by the speaker and a receiver (with
earphone) worn by the listener.

13. 6-Dec-12 Assistive Technology
Listening
Variable Speed Tape Recorders:
Tape recorders/players allow a user to listen to pre-
recorded text or to capture spoken information and
play it back later.
This tape recorders speed up or slow down the
playback rate without distorting the "speaker's" voice.
D.E.T. , S.N.D.T. Women’s University
13
14. 6-Dec-12 Assistive Technology
Math
Assistive technology (AT) tools for math are
designed to help people who struggle with
computing, organizing, aligning, and copying
math problems down on paper.
With the help of visual and/or audio
support, learners can better set up and calculate
basic math problems.
Few examples of AT for Math are:
› Electronic Math Worksheet
› Talking Calculator
D.E.T. , S.N.D.T. Women’s University
14
15. 6-Dec-12 Assistive Technology
Math
Electronic Math Worksheet:
Electronic math worksheets are software programs
that can help a user organize, align, and work through
math problems on a computer screen.
Numbers that appear onscreen can also be read aloud
via a speech synthesizer.
This is helpful to people who have trouble aligning
math problems with pencil and paper.
D.E.T. , S.N.D.T. Women’s University
15
16. 6-Dec-12 Assistive Technology
Math
Talking Calculator
A talking calculator has a built-in speech synthesizer
that reads aloud each number, symbol, or operation
key a user presses and vocalizes the answer to the
problem.
This auditory feedback helps the learner to check the
accuracy of the keys he/she presses and verify the
answer before he/she transfers it to paper.

18. 6-Dec-12 Assistive Technology
Organisation &
Memory
Assistive technology (AT) tools for organisation and
memory are designed to help a person
plan, organize, and keep track of his
calendar, schedule, task list, contact information, and
miscellaneous notes.
These tools allow him to manage, store, and retrieve
information.
Few examples of AT for organisation & memory are:
› Information/Data Managers
› Graphic Organisers and Outlining Programs
D.E.T. , S.N.D.T. Women’s University
18
19. 6-Dec-12 Assistive Technology
Organisation &
Memory
Information/Data Managers:
This tool helps learners to plan, organize, store, and
retrieve his calendar, task list, contact data, and other
information in electronic form.
Personal data managers may be portable, hand-held
devices, computer software, or a combination of
those tools working together to share data.
D.E.T. , S.N.D.T. Women’s University
19
20. 6-Dec-12 Assistive Technology
Organisation &
Memory
Graphic Organisers and Outlining Programs:
Graphic organizers and outlining programs help users
who have trouble organizing and outlining information
as they begin a writing project.
This type of program lets a user "dump" information in
an unstructured manner and later helps him organize
the information into appropriate categories and order.

22. 6-Dec-12 Assistive Technology
Reading
Assistive technology (AT) for reading help
individuals who struggle with reading.
These tools help facilitate decoding, reading
fluency, and comprehension.
While each type of tool works a little
differently, all of these tools help by
presenting text as speech.
Few examples of AT tools for reading:
› Audio Books and Publications
› Optical Character Recognition
D.E.T. , S.N.D.T. Women’s University
22
23. 6-Dec-12 Assistive Technology
Reading
Audio Books and Publications:
Recorded books allow users to listen to text and are
available in a variety of formats, such as
audiocassettes, CDs, and MP3 downloads.
Subscription services offer extensive electronic library
collections.
D.E.T. , S.N.D.T. Women’s University
23
24. 6-Dec-12 Assistive Technology
Reading
Optical Character Recognition:
This technology allows a user to scan printed material
into a computer or handheld unit.
The scanned text is then read aloud via a speech
synthesis/screen reading system.
Optical Character Recognition (OCR) is available as
stand-alone units, computer software, and as
portable, pocket-sized devices.
Portable reading device downloads books and then
reads them out loud in a synthesized voice.

26. 6-Dec-12 Assistive Technology
Writing
Assistive technology (AT) tools for writing help
learners who struggle with writing.
Some of these tools help learners avoid the
actual physical task of writing, while some
facilitate proper spelling, punctuation, grammar,
word usage, and organization.
Few examples of AT tools for writing:
› Abbreviation expanders
› Alternative keyboards
› Talking spell checkers and electronic dictionaries
D.E.T. , S.N.D.T. Women’s University
26
27. 6-Dec-12 Assistive Technology
Writing
Abbreviation expanders:
This software program allows a user to
create, store, and re-use abbreviations for frequently-
used words or phrases and it is used with word
processing.
D.E.T. , S.N.D.T. Women’s University
27
28. 6-Dec-12 Assistive Technology
Writing
Alternative keyboards:
Alternative keyboards have special overlays that
customize the appearance and function of a standard
keyboard.
Students who have trouble typing may benefit from
customization that reduces input choices, groups keys
by colour/location, and adds graphics to aid
comprehension.
D.E.T. , S.N.D.T. Women’s University
28
29. 6-Dec-12 Assistive Technology
Writing
Talking spell checkers and electronic dictionaries:
Talking spell checkers and electronic dictionaries can
help a poor speller select or identify appropriate words
and correct spelling errors during the process of
writing and proofreading.
Talking devices "read aloud" and display the selected
words onscreen, so the user can see and hear the
words.
